WebMagnetic bead separation can practically be done equipment-free. Here's what happens during the process: 1. Magnetic Beads are Added to the Samples. When the magnetic beads are added to the samples, the DNA will bind to them. The beads have several layers, with the core wrapped by a layer of magnetite. The first isolation of de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) was done in 1869 by Friedrich Miescher. DNA extraction is the process of isolating DNA from the cells of an organism isolated from a sample, typically a biological sample such as blood, saliva, or tissue . It involves breaking open the cells, removing proteins and other contaminants, and purifying the DNA so that it is free of other cellular components. WebMay 3, 2015 · Capillary electrophoresis is a high-throughput separation method commonly employed for DNA analysis owing to rapid analysis times and small sample volumes. Various modes of capillary electrophoresis, which are summarized in Table 1, are used depending upon the application. WebIn order to conduct DNA separation by silica adsorption, a sample (this may be anything from purified cells to a tissue specimen) is lysed, releasing proteins, DNA, phospholipids, etc. from the cells. The remaining tissue is discarded. The supernatant containing the DNA is then exposed to silica in a solution with high ionic strength.

Semen analysis was performed … shower redi tile panWebMar 20, 2024 · PCR is a three-step process that is carried out in repeated cycles. The initial step is the denaturation, or separation, of the two strands of the DNA molecule.
